Game Recap
In a thrilling contest, the California Golden Bears edged out the Washington State Cougars with a final score of 42-39 on November 11, 2023. The game featured a series of dramatic plays and high-stakes moments, keeping fans on the edge of their seats. From the outset, the Cougars and Golden Bears traded blows, with defensive highlights and offensive fireworks.
The Golden Bears were bolstered by a strong rushing attack led by Jaydn Ott, while Washington State's aerial assault was spearheaded by Cameron Ward. Key defensive plays, including multiple fumble recoveries returned for touchdowns, defined the game's narrative. Ultimately, California's timely defensive stands and efficient offensive drives sealed their victory in this high-scoring affair.

Standout Players:
Jaydn Ott (California Golden Bears, RB)
Scored two crucial touchdowns, rushing 27 times for 167 yards, and adding 18 receiving yards.Cameron Ward (Washington State Cougars, QB)
Passed for 354 yards and 3 touchdowns, also adding 1 rushing touchdown in a dynamic performance.Josh Kelly (Washington State Cougars, WR)
Had 9 receptions for 130 yards and a crucial touchdown that kept the Cougars in contention.Cade Uluave (California Golden Bears, LB)
Recovered a fumble and returned it 51 yards for a touchdown, providing a defensive spark for the Bears.Nohl Williams (California Golden Bears, DB)
Secured a pivotal fumble recovery returned for a 52-yard touchdown, significantly impacting the game's outcome.Fernando Mendoza (California Golden Bears, QB)
Maintained efficiency with a 66.7% completion rate, throwing for 2 touchdowns and keeping the offense steady.
